solve the following system of equations using matrices
4x-2y=7
7x+y=13

Matrices for such a simple system?
ok ....
we need the inverse of
4 -2
7 1
I will assume you know how to find the inverse of a 2by2
I get
1/18 2/18
-7/18 4/18
now if we multiply that by
4 -2
7 1
we get
1 0
0 1 on left and the column matrix
33/18
3/18 on the right
so x = 33/18 or 11/6
and y = 3/18 or 1/6
OR
from the 2nd: y = 13-7x
sub into the 1st:
4x - 2(13-7x) = 7
4x - 26 + 14x = 7
18x = 33
x = 33/18 = 11/6
back into 2nd:
7(11/6) + y = 13
y = 13 - 77/6 = 1/6
